Details
A vulnerability classified as critical was found in Zoho ManageEngine Applications Manager 12/13 (Log Management Software). Affected by this vulnerability is an unknown functionality of the component Java Object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a deserialization v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-502. The product deserializes untrusted data without sufficiently verifying that the resulting data will be valid.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:
ManageEngine Applications Manager 12 and 13, allows unserialization of unsafe Java objects. The vulnerability can be exploited by remote user without authentication and it allows to execute remote code compromising the application as well as the operating system. As Application Manager's RMI registry is running with privileges of system administrator, by exploiting this vulnerability an attacker gains highest privileges on the underlying operating system.
The bug was discovered 04/04/2017. The weakness was published 07/13/2018 by Lukasz Juszczyk as not defined mailinglist post (Full-Disclosure). The advisory is shared at seclists.org.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2016-9498 since 11/21/2016.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ploitation doesn't need any form of authentication. Neither technical details nor an exploit are publicly available.
The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 465 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$0-$5k.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 13202 (Zoho ManageEngine Applications Manager Multiple Security Vulnerabilities).
There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
